首页 > 试题广场 >

设有一个数据项集合(A,B,C,D,E),给定数据依赖如下:

[问答题]
设有一个数据项集合(A,B,C,D,E),给定数据依赖如下:A B→C,B→A,C→D,D→E
请问T(A,B,C,D,E)达到第几范式?如果不属于3NF,开始作规范化设计,推出2NF,继续推出3NF,并说明理由。
(不知道对不对) 不存在部分依赖,存在传递依赖 2NF (A,B,C) (B,D) (B,E)
发表于 2018-10-14 11:08:39 回复(0)
可以得出候选码为B
所以主属性为B,ACDE为非主属性。
然而B→A可以推出B→AB,而A B→C,所以C传递函数依赖于B,所以不属于第三范式,只属于第二范式。


发表于 2020-05-09 09:28:10 回复(0)
够候选码是abc 存在c~d所以有非主属性对码的部分函数依赖 所以是第一范式
发表于 2019-03-13 21:58:42 回复(0)